The Postgraduate Certificate in Environmental Impact of Building Materials has become increasingly significant in today's market, driven by the growing awareness of sustainability and environmental concerns. In the UK, for instance, the construction industry is under pressure to reduce its carbon footprint, with the government aiming to achieve net-zero carbon emissions by 2050. According to the UK's Building Research Establishment (BRE), the built environment is responsible for around 40% of the country's greenhouse gas emissions. This highlights the need for professionals in the construction industry to have a deep understanding of the environmental impact of building materials.
